Percolata

Percolata is a Palo Alto, California predictive-analytics company that applies machine learning to help retailers optimize labor scheduling and marketing spend. Its platform forecasts hourly sales, in-store traffic, and takeout demand to drive staffing optimization and marketing budget allocation, with published claims of 4x higher forecast accuracy, 10-20% same-store sales lift, and a forecast-accuracy guarantee. Named customers include 7-Eleven, Uniqlo, and Telefonica. The company is backed by Andreessen Horowitz (a16z) and Google Ventures (GV). Percolata does not publish a public developer portal or REST API reference; its retail platform is delivered as a managed product with custom application integration.
